They Turned Marshal into Canine Fondue, I Reborn to End Their Feast Chapter 1

My father returned from the battlefield with a military dog named Marshal, a hero who earned first-class honors.

However, the poor student I sponsored tried to curry favor with my fiancé by cooking Marshal into a canine fondue.

My fiancé casually picked up a piece of meat at the dinner table and said lightly, "It's just a dog. If it's dead, we'll buy another one. She did go out of her way for you, you know."

What he never realized was that Marshal was our family's guardian spirit. After his death, misfortune struck us one after another.

The company collapsed, my parents died in a car crash and my fiancé had me confined to an asylum, a place where I endured daily torment until my miserable death.

When I opened my eyes again, I was back at that "canine fondue" dinner.

The poor student was just placing the pot of boiling red broth on the table, gazing at my fiancé with a fawning smile.

Meanwhile, my fiancé tenderly scooped a plate for me. "Try it, she made this especially for you."

I took the plate with a smile. Then, to their shock, I picked up the phone and dialed my father's old comrade-in-arms.

"Uncle Alaric, my fiancé said he wanted to try the taste of a first-class honored dog and I saved a portion for you. When would you like to come and get it?"

——

There was a moment of silence on the other end.

A deathly silence.

I could even imagine the stormy expression on Alaric's perpetually serious, square-shaped face at that moment.

Darius's gentle smile froze.

His handsome features darkened slightly, like he hadn't quite processed what I said.

"Astrid, what kind of joke is this?"

Beside him, Nicolette Vane, the impoverished student I had sponsored for five years, instantly turned pale.

Her shaking hand made the boiling hot red broth splash onto the back of her hand, giving it a bright burn.

She stared at me innocently and terrified, as if she had no idea what was happening.

"Astrid, I ... I didn't mean to. I just heard Darius say he wanted to eat something special, so I … "

Her words dissolved into tears, dripping down like broken strings of pearls.

This pitiful act had completely fooled me in my last life. Even after she killed Marshal, I still thought she was just naive.

How ridiculous!

I ignored her, quietly waiting for a response from the other end of the call.

Meanwhile, Darius's patience had clearly run out. He snatched my phone, his tone filled with condescending impatience and charity.

"Whoever you are, Astrid's in a bad mood today. Just let it go."

He was about to hang up.

When Alaric's thunderous voice suddenly roared through the phone, it was so loud and commanding that it rattled in our ears.

"Let it go? Who the hell do you think you are to decide that?"

"Put Astrid on the phone!"

An expression of surprise crossed Darius's face for the first time as he stood motionless, gripping the phone tightly.

I pulled the phone from his hand and put it back to my ear.

"Uncle Alaric, I'm fine."

"Send me the address. I'll be right there."

Alaric's voice was beyond dispute and then the call ended. The living room fell into an eerie silence.

Darius stared at me, his gaze searching and uneasy, like I'd suddenly become someone unfamiliar.

"Astrid, since when have you known someone like him?"

There was a subtle edge of offense in his voice, like his pride had been hurt.

Slowly, I pushed the plate of "Marshal's meat" that he had so thoughtfully served me toward the center of the table.

The sauce bubbled hot, chunks of meat swirling in it, giving off a sickeningly rich aroma.

"Darius, didn't you say that Nicole tried her best for me?"
